Loma destroyed Gary Russell in his 3rd fight. An undefeated champ. Gary russell beats 94% of everyone in his division. Then destroyed Nicholas Walters, who was considered a beast after he dismantled Donaire. Ko'ed Rigondeaux who was considered the best at that time & crushed Jorge Linares....No other boxer has beaten world champions and killers in such a short period of time. Loma is #1 P4P without question.
